  • Who are we?

    We look at the relationship between the body, brain and mind and how they interact in chronic and complex pain disorders.
    Lorimer Moseley, NHMRC Senior Research Fellow at NeuRA and Collaborators explore how the mind influences physiological regulation of the body and how we can teach people about it all in a way that is both interesting and accurate.
